Hi Hackers,

Due to the limitations of HTML Canvas, if the image exceeds max
width/height of 32767 then the image becomes empty.
To fix this, I have set the max limit of width and height to 32767. The ERD
diagram will be cut if it exceeds the limit. The ERD tool will also throw
an alert to inform the user in that case.
Please review.

diff --git a/web/pgadmin/tools/erd/static/js/erd_tool/ui_components/BodyWidget.jsx b/web/pgadmin/tools/erd/static/js/erd_tool/ui_components/BodyWidget.jsx
index 2b598d808..8b7d77aee 100644
--- a/web/pgadmin/tools/erd/static/js/erd_tool/ui_components/BodyWidget.jsx
+++ b/web/pgadmin/tools/erd/static/js/erd_tool/ui_components/BodyWidget.jsx
@@ -657,11 +657,24 @@ export default class BodyWidget extends React.Component {
     };
 
     setTimeout(()=>{
+      let width = this.canvasEle.scrollWidth + 10;
+      let height = this.canvasEle.scrollHeight + 10;
+      let isCut = false;
+      /* Canvas limitation - https://html2canvas.hertzen.com/faq */
+      if(width >= 32767){
+        width = 32766;
+        isCut = true;
+      }
+      if(height >= 32767){
+        height = 32766;
+        isCut = true;
+      }
       html2canvas(this.canvasEle, {
-        width: this.canvasEle.scrollWidth + 10,
-        height: this.canvasEle.scrollHeight + 10,
+        width: width,
+        height: height,
         scrollX: 0,
         scrollY: 0,
+        scale: 1,
         useCORS: true,
         allowTaint: true,
         backgroundColor: window.getComputedStyle(this.canvasEle).backgroundColor,
@@ -691,6 +704,10 @@ export default class BodyWidget extends React.Component {
           ele.style.transform = prevTransform;
         });
         this.setLoading(null);
+        if(isCut) {
+          Notify.alert(gettext('Maximum image size limit'),
+            gettext('The downloaded image it cut to maximum limit of 32767 x 32767 pixels. This happens when the ERD dimension size has exceeded the maximum limit.'));
+        }
       });
     }, 1000);
   }
